How to use the Rutland Traffic Map. Traffic flow lines: Red lines = Heavy traffic flow, Yellow/Orange lines = Medium flow and Green = normal traffic or no traffic*. Black lines or No traffic flow lines could indicate a closed road, but in most cases it means that either there is not enough vehicle flow to register or traffic isn't monitored.

Explore! Closed circuit TV images can also be found on the New England 511 website. Like Road Weather Stations, toggle the Cameras option on in the map legend. Creating an account in New England 511 enables users to save map views, saving custom camera views, setting up notifications for areas and routes, among many other features. ABOUT. The Online Map Center (OMC) is intended to be the source for VTrans-specific maps at VTrans. From this page, you will be able to access two type of maps, the first are static maps. These maps are image files of paper maps within the Agency.
